I see a lot of people in the forum mention using a plotter to make stencils. Is that different than a cutter?
My friend's wife got a Silhouette Cameo for Christmas. Yesterday, he and I got to use it. I cut out a ninja design, put it on a disc, and easily weeded the unwanted vinyl. It looked awesome! Sadly, when I dyed it, it bled all over the place. Very blurry image. I used iDye mixed in rubbing alcohol and painted it on the disc.
To be fair, I've had mixed results with this technique on xacto-cut stencils, but this was the worst disc I've made. Has anyone else used this type of stencil maker? Is a plotter that much different?
